Synopsis

The book explores how mathematical biology can be made accessible through storytelling and culturally relevant examples from Indian contexts. It discusses how mathematical thinking emerges from biological observation, covering topics such as evolution, genetics, conservation, and disease ecology. The book includes practice problems, Python code, and real-world applications like tiger conservation, epidemic modeling, network analysis, and climate change.
